Update: Shooting victim, suspect identified
Crime-Scene-Tape

The victim in Wednesday's shooting has been identified as Clyde A. Weeks, 19 of Hinesville. According to HPD Chief of Detectives Chris Reid, Weeks was shot multiple times during an altercation.

Reid said Philemon Jackson, 21 has been arrested and charged with murder, three counts of aggravated assault and possession of a weapon in the commission of a felony. He has made a first appearance where bond is expected to be denied.

Earlier story:

Hinesville police are investigating a fatal shooting outside a home on Jubail Drive in Eagles Landing subdivision, according to sources.

Hinesville Police Department Detective Susie Jackson said the shooting occurred shortly after 5 p.m. Wednesday and a victim was taken to Liberty Regional Medical Center, but the victim's identity was not released. 

A person of interest is being questioned, Jackson said. 

Liberty County Coroner Reginald Pierce later confirmed his office responded to a shooting death in Hinesville Wednesday, but Pierce also did not release the victim's name.
